Individuals who are addicted to alcohol or drugs may not reach out for the help they require, before it is too late. Loved ones frequently have to intervene to obtain them help, and it's important that anyone looking for effective drug and alcohol treatment understand what forms of drug rehab in Oaks, Missouri are available and those that will prove most ideal. Don't assume all drug rehab in Oaks, MO. is the same, by way of example there are short-term drug rehab facilities and long-term facilities, as well as outpatient and inpatient programs. In addition there are residential facilities, and such a drug rehab in Oaks is a great environment for those who go with a long-term rehab option, because they'll be in drug rehab in Oaks, Missouri for a while and these kinds of facilities offer a lot of the comforts and amenities of home.

Many people seeking drug rehab in Oaks, MO. or their family who are seeking a treatment option lean towards programs and rehabilitation facilities which will return the addicted individual home and also to their typical lives as quickly as possible. Naturally anyone that is in drug and alcohol rehab would like to complete the process and get back to their obligations, families, etc. as quickly as possible. That is why outpatient and short-term drug rehab in Oaks seems like the best rehab alternative for addicted individuals along with their families. Sometimes however, individuals develop a deep physical and in many cases psychological dependency to drugs and/or alcohol which makes these seemingly convenient drug rehab in Oaks, Missouri options inviable.

While at first in any type of drug rehab in Oaks, MO., people who are just recently abstaining from alcohol are detoxed and preferably assisted through this, with withdrawal made a bit easier through the help of detoxification experts. Even though someone is detoxed however, they are still likely to experience intense cravings to consume alcohol or use drugs, cravings which can persist for a long time. Many people claim that they experience such cravings for the remainder of their lives, but ideally cope through these with the life tools and workable coping methods they acquire in an effective Oaks drug rehab. Let's say someone is within an outpatient drug rehab in Oaks, Missouri while still experiencing these extreme cravings, and go back home on a daily basis when it's in rehab. Reports say that drug abuse is often times triggered by environmental elements, including life stressors, or perhaps individuals their environment who may trigger it. This could be an abusive relationship, somebody who promotes and participates in the person's habit or some other situation that could prompt the individual to go to alcohol or drugs as a social aid, as an escape or to self medicate. This will make an outpatient situation the least ideal, since the whole reason for drug rehab in Oaks, MO. ought to be to resolve all of these situations while there. This is why relapses are really typical with outpatient drug rehab.

Also, short-term drug rehab in Oaks which offers rehabilitation for 30 days or fewer are truly the least ideal rehabilitation settings even if receiving inpatient or residential rehab. As mentioned earlier, those who have recently abstained from alcohol and drugs need a substantial amount of time to recover physically and also stabilize from the dependence a result of their drug abuse. After just a few weeks, individuals in drug rehab in Oaks, Missouri are just acclimating to a drug free lifestyle, and learning how to adjust physically, psychologically, and emotionally without their drug of choice. This leaves not much time to allow them to clearly target what can actually assist them to conserve a drug free and healthy lifestyle once they go back home, which can take quite a while for those who might need to make significant and life changing decisions and changes in lifestyle.

Long-term drug rehab in Oaks, MO. is a perfect treatment option for various reasons, but it gives you the required change of environment as well as the intensity of treatment needed for those who need to reap all the rewards of treatment and be able to sustain these successes once they go back home to their normal lives. Long-term drug rehab in Oaks is available in either an inpatient or residential rehab center, with the main differences being inpatient provides treatment services for many who make require medical treatment as part of their rehabilitation process. This could be true for a person who is experiencing a physical ailment or life threatening disease which might have been worsened due to their substance abuse, or somebody that may require help being weaned from medical drugs which they have grown to be dependent to.

Regarding long-term residential drug rehab in Oaks, Missouri, these programs offer lots of the comforts of home therefore the individual can feel comfortable throughout the often lengthy alcohol and drug treatment process. Though it may be tough to be away from loved ones while in rehabilitation for several months, this kind of program helps it be much easier to endure through the process. And after all, the sacrifice makes it worth it in the end when the individual can go back home able to live a happy, productive and drug-free lifestyle.
